苏州城市规划区地下空间开发适宜性评价

摘    要:结合苏州城市规划区的地质环境特点,选取地形地貌、建筑场地类别、不良岩土体、水文条件、地质灾害等5个方面13个因子作为地下空间资源开发适宜性评价指标,运用层次分析法(AHP)确定各指标因子的权重,采用多目标线性加权函数建立评价数学模型,利用GIS叠加生成适宜性评价图。结果表明:西部基岩山区地质环境条件较好,适宜地下空间开发,东部平原区水系发育,软土层较厚,水文条件复杂,地下空间开发适宜性相对较差。

On development suitability appraisal of underground space in Suzhou urban planning zone

Abstract:In combination with the geological and environmental characteristics in the urban planning zone in Suzhou, the authors se- lected five aspects (landforrns, site sorts, poor rock mass, hydrogeological conditions and geological disasters) and thirteen factors as evaluation index for development suitability of underground space resource, determined the weight of each index factor with analytic hi- erarchy process(AHP) , established appraisal mathematical model by adopting multi-objective linear weighting function, and formed suitability map by GIS superposition. It was concluded that the western bedrock areas were suitable for development of underground space owing to its fine geological and environmental conditions, the eastern flatlands were relatively poor in suitability of underground space development owing to their drainage development, thick layers of soft soils and complicated hydrological conditions.
